Job Summary:

The Cook at Phoenix Society is responsible for preparing meals and following established recipes. Key duties include preparing ingredients, adhering to the menu, and following food health and safety procedures. The position is required to cook, clean, assist other kitchen staff, and deliver food in a fast-paced environment. The Cook ensures that menu items are of high quality and distributed in a timely fashion. Also from time to time able to work for sister sites and phoenix food truck as needed.

Responsibilites:

  • Set up, clean and organize work stations with all necessary supplies
  • Prepare ingredients for the day; wash, chop and season meat, vegetables, etc.
  • Prepare and cook menu items according to nutritional standards with other kitchen staff
  • Handle multiple food orders at one time
  • Deliver menu items to clients as required
  • Store and dispose of any food properly
  • Ensure sufficient stock and inventory of food, supplies and equipment
  • Sanitize and clean work stations and kitchen supplies
  • Comply with health and safety and sanitation standards
  • Ensure that food is distributed in high quality and in a timely fashion
  • Perform other duties as required

Qualifications:

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Red Seal certification is required
  • 1 to 3 years of experience in preparing, cooking and delivering meals
  • Satisfactory completion of a criminal records check with vulnerable sector screening is required
  • Satisfactory completion of Tuberculosis Screening form is required
  • Satisfactory completion of Employee Immunization Record form is required
  • First aid certification with CPR is required
  • Food Safe Level 1 is required
